FooDB NameChrysoeriol 7-glucuronide
DescriptionChrysoeriol 7-glucuronide is a member of the class of compounds known as flavonoid-7-o-glucuronides. Flavonoid-7-o-glucuronides are phenolic compounds containing a flavonoid moiety which is O-glycosidically linked to glucuronic acid at the C7-position. Chrysoeriol 7-glucuronide is slightly soluble (in water) and a moderately acidic compound (based on its pKa). Chrysoeriol 7-glucuronide can be found in parsley, which makes chrysoeriol 7-glucuronide a potential biomarker for the consumption of this food product.
